Zetti Magic

Last weekend I gathered my Zetti stamps and started to prepare a few ATCs for a Zetti themed swap in one of my ATC groups. When I came back to them today, they turned out completely different, and I think that´s the magic of Zettiology - when you´re in the process of making something Zetti styled, your thoughts tend to go wild and you get into a creative swirl and never know what you´ll end up with.
